引言
随着人工智能技术的飞速发展,大模型在后端应用领域展现出巨大的潜力。它们不仅能够处理大规模数据,还能为开发者提供高效便捷的开发体验。本文将深入探讨大模型后端的奥秘,解析其在高效开发中的关键作用。
一、大模型后端概述
1.1 定义
大模型后端是指基于深度学习技术构建的,能够处理海量数据、提供高效服务、具有自适应能力的后端系统。
1.2 特点
- 处理能力强:能够处理大规模、高复杂度的数据。
- 效率高:通过优化算法和硬件加速,实现高效数据处理。
- 自适应:根据用户需求和环境变化,动态调整服务策略。
二、大模型后端高效开发的关键技术
2.1 深度学习框架
深度学习框架是构建大模型后端的核心,常见的框架有TensorFlow、PyTorch等。
- TensorFlow:由Google开发,拥有强大的生态和丰富的API。
- PyTorch:由Facebook开发,以动态计算图著称。
2.2 算法优化
- 模型压缩:通过模型剪枝、量化等方法减小模型大小,提高模型效率。
- 加速算法:采用GPU、FPGA等硬件加速,提高模型推理速度。
2.3 数据处理
- 数据预处理:对原始数据进行清洗、转换等操作,提高数据处理效率。
- 分布式计算:利用多台服务器进行并行计算,提高数据处理速度。
2.4 服务优化
- 负载均衡:根据请求流量,动态分配服务器资源,提高服务稳定性。
- 缓存机制:缓存热点数据,减少数据访问时间,提高系统性能。
三、大模型后端应用案例
3.1 人工智能推荐系统
大模型后端在推荐系统中的应用,可以快速为用户提供个性化的推荐结果,提高用户满意度。
3.2 智能语音识别
大模型后端在智能语音识别领域的应用,可以实现实时语音识别,提高语音处理效率。
3.3 机器翻译
大模型后端在机器翻译领域的应用,可以实现准确、流畅的跨语言交流,降低翻译成本。
四、总结
大模型后端为开发者提供了高效便捷的开发体验,其背后蕴含着丰富的技术和实践经验。掌握大模型后端技术,将为开发者带来更多机遇和挑战。在未来的发展中,大模型后端将继续发挥重要作用,推动人工智能技术的进步。